#0a59c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a59c4 is composed of 3.9% red, 34.9%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 54.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 214.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 40.4%. #0a59c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#14b2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0a59c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0a59c4 has RGB values of R:10, G:89,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 678340.

Shades and Tints of #0a59c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000409 is the darkest color, while #f6f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a59c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61666d is the less saturated color, while #0258cc is the most saturated one.
